Made it here late February as I was visiting a friend in Spring. With his location near the…read moreGosling food truck park, we ventured back here to try some other trucks and see what they got. Noticing Cuban eats with this truck, I decided on the Cuban oxtails special with the plaintain chips and rice/peas (beans) made. The oxtails were tender greasy and came of the bone very easily. Rice and peas had good flavor and the plaintain chips had nice texture with a touch of sweetness. It's pricy at just under $30; but that's due to oxtail prices increasing over the years. Of course I prefer to pay less but who wouldn't? Other menu items include cuban frijoles, salads, pastas, pastries, pizzas, and rice dishes. Not sure of the schedule for this truck as there's been times at this park where I didn't see them open. Good thing I caught them on the last Sunday in February. Definitely will try the other items when I'm back here. Gosling food truck park comes through again!

I had been meaning to try this food truck for some time and finally caught them open. I got a…read moredinner platter with shredded beef, beans and rice, some plantains, and a side salad. The shredded beef dish is absolutely the best Cuban food I have ever had. The beef was moist and tender, and beautifully seasoned. Just the right amount of fat for good mouth feel. The rice and beans soaked up this flavor and made the dish complete. I would eat this again anytime. The plantains were well cooked and a nice semi-sweet complement to the meal. The salad was lightly dressed and was also a good complement. The truck is one of the less flashy ones in the Plaza De Los Food Trucks, so you have to know the food and want it. I found their menu a little confusing--it lists all the components of a plate separately, and it's not clear how you would build a combo. Our server that evening did not speak English and our Spanish is not that good, but she got her husband on the phone and everything went well. They are very polite people. The menu lists desserts but they didn't have any that evening. I would look forward to trying them another time. I definitely want to pay another visit, perhaps to try the pork platter or the paella (not listed on the menu).
